The Role of Software Providers
The quality of the gaming experience is heavily reliant on the software providers powering the platform. Companies like NetEnt, Microgaming, Play’n GO, and Evolution Gaming are industry leaders, known for their visually stunning graphics, immersive sound design, and innovative gameplay mechanics. These providers invest heavily in research and development, consistently pushing the boundaries of what’s possible in online gaming. Partnering with these reputable developers is a sign that a casino is committed to providing a high-quality experience. Furthermore, these providers often submit their games to independent testing agencies to ensure fairness and randomness, giving players additional confidence in the integrity of the games.
| Software Provider | Game Specialization | Key Features |
|---|---|---|
| NetEnt | Slots, Table Games, Live Casino | High-quality graphics, innovative themes, frequent releases |
| Microgaming | Slots, Progressive Jackpots, Poker | Extensive game library, renowned progressive jackpots, established reputation |
| Play’n GO | Slots, Mobile Gaming | Focus on mobile optimization, engaging gameplay, popular titles like Book of Dead |
| Evolution Gaming | Live Casino | Immersive live dealer experience, professional dealers, multiple camera angles |

Understanding Wagering Requirements
Wagering requirements are arguably the most important aspect of any casino bonus. They represent the total amount a player must bet before they can cash out any winnings derived from the bonus.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means that if a player receives a $100 bonus, they must wager $3,000 before withdrawing any associated winnings. It's also important to consider that not all games contribute equally to fulfilling wagering requirements. Slots typically contribute 100%, while table games like blackjack and roulette may only contribute a smaller percentage, such as 10% or 20%. This means players will need to play more of those games to meet the requirements. A thorough understanding of these nuances is vital for maximizing the value of any bonus offer.

Tools for Responsible Gaming
Recognizing the potential for problem gambling, responsible casinos provide players with a range of tools to manage their gaming habits. These include deposit limits, loss limits, self-exclusion options, and access to support resources. Deposit limits allow players to restrict the amount of money they can deposit into their account within a specific timeframe. Loss limits similarly restrict the amount of money a player can lose over a set period. Self-exclusion allows players to temporarily or permanently block their access to the casino. These tools empower players to take control of their gaming and prevent it from becoming a problem. A responsible casino will actively promote these tools and encourage players to use them.
